Frequently Asked Questions
How many IP addresses does City of Indianapolis own?
City of Indianapolis controls 67.6K IPv4 addresses distributed across 2 CIDR ranges. The organization is registered in United States.
What ASNs does City of Indianapolis operate?
City of Indianapolis operates 1 Autonomous System. Each ASN represents an independently routed network that City of Indianapolis manages for internet traffic delivery.
What type of organization is City of Indianapolis?
City of Indianapolis is categorized as government. This classification is based on the organization's primary use of its IP address allocations.
